支付流程
2023-11-23 15:43:57 0 举报
用户在商城选购商品并发起支付请求; 商城将支付订单通过B2C网关收款接口传送至支付网关; 用户选择网银支付及银行,支付平台将订单转送至指定银行网关界面; 用户支付完成,银行处理结果并向平台返回处理结果; 支付平台接收处理结果,落地处理并向商户返回结果; 商城接收到支付公司返回结果,落地处理(更改订单状态)并通知用户。
作者其他创作
大纲/内容
返回支付宝app支付签名后的数据
支付系统
选择支付宝支付
计算业务逻辑,生成订单信息
修改订单状态
返回结果
发起支付
未收到支付通知
通知商品状态
返回最终支付结果
收到直接返回
创建订单
通知业务系统
分布式雪花算法
查询结果
异步支付通知
展示结果
支付宝系统
返回订单编号
判断支付结果,是否接到到通知
用户
完成支付
同步返回支付结果
同步支付结果返回商户端,验证,解析支付结果
获取订单编号
调用支付宝查询订单接口查询结果
处理订单状态
订单系统
显示支付结果
接受响应
发起支付宝支付
确认支付
保存订单数据
返回支付结果
购买产品
生成签名后的支付数据
App
支付宝SDK
验证通知结果
调用sdk
业务系统
输入密码
网关系统
收藏
收藏
0 条评论
下一页